The interesting thing is that when I SSH
into the Minikube
, and hit the service using curl 10.96.91.44:8000
it respects the LoadBalancer
type of the service and rotates between all three pods as I hit the endpoints time and again. I can see that in the returned results which I have made sure to include the HOSTNAME of the pod.
但是,当我尝试使用kubectl port-forward service/myproj-app-service 8000:8000
从Hosting Mac访问服务时,每次碰到端点时,都会得到相同的Pod进行响应.它没有负载平衡.我可以很清楚地看到,当我kubectl logs -f <pod>
到所有三个Pod时,只有其中一个正在处理命中,而另外两个则处于闲置状态...
However, when I try to access the service from my Hosting Mac -- using kubectl port-forward service/myproj-app-service 8000:8000
-- Every time I hit the endpoint, I get the same pod to respond. It doesn't load balance. I can see that clearly when I kubectl logs -f <pod>
to all three pods and only one of them is handling the hits, as the other two are idle...
这是kubectl port-forward
限制还是问题?还是我在这里错过了更大的东西?
Is this a kubectl port-forward
limitation or issue? or am I missing something greater here?

The reason was that my pods were randomly in a crashing state due to Python *.pyc files that were left in the container. This causes issues when Django is running in a multi-pod Kubernetes deployment. Once I removed this issue and all pods ran successfully, the round-robin started working.
